Output 6d68c3809b0ea89eb5e5f4c4a549857fdd551c17fb7a95a4420af96091cae2c9:0

value
26544402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c43207972fd34ebf3a8f6b9565a60ede2b1272e OP_EQUAL
address
MErQ14iKfhMrR1Pcyy5snwMmhzuLhznjYA
transaction
6d68c3809b0ea89eb5e5f4c4a549857fdd551c17fb7a95a4420af96091cae2c9
spent
true